C 求一元二次方程最值
来源:学生作业帮助网 编辑:作业帮 时间:2024/04/29 17:06:16
首先,我觉得你说的不是一元二次方程,而是一个二次函数吧?方程只有根,没有最值.\x0d一个函数y=ax2+bx+c对应一条抛物线,它的最值分为以下几种情况:\x0d第一种,x没有限制,可以取到整个定义
你可以自己编一个程序来创建测试数据啊,别忘了有“random()”函数和“randomize”的(PASCAL)再问:哦对但我还要解好麻烦呵呵所以就求助于度娘了再答:比赛时他们只给一两组测试数据,其他
解一元二次方程的基本思想方法是通过“降次”将它化为两个一元一次方程.一元二次方程有四种解法: 1、直接开平方法;2、配方法;3、公式法;4、因式分解法.1、直接开平方法: 直接开平方法就是用直接开
#include"stdio.h"#include"math.h"/*求一元二次方程ax*x+bx+c=0的解*/main(){floata,b,c,x1,x2,d;printf("请输入a:");s
//只一处有错,还有一个注意输入格式.#include#includeintmain(){doublep,q,x1,x2,disc,a,b,c;scanf("%lf,%lf,%lf",&a,&b,&c
ax^2+bx+c=0Δ=b^2-4ac当Δ
下面判断有问题,d都已经开根号了怎么还判断是否大于零呢,应该在开根号之前判断另外语法问题else后面的(d
double改做float再问:yiyuanercifangcheng.cpp(25):warningC4244:'=':conversionfrom'int'to'float',possiblelo
#include#includeintmain(){doublea,b,c,disc,p,q,x1,x2;scanf("%lf%lf%lf",&a,&b,&c);disc=b*b-4*a*c;if(a
#include#includeintmain(){floatf(float);floatm=0;inta=-10,b=10;//a,b为大致区间可以自己修改while(fabs(f(m))>
您好!很高兴为您解答.如果刨除输入格式的问题,输入的那一行“scanf("%1f,%1f,%1f",&a,&b,&c);”应该改为“scanf("
如果,原式能分解因式,那就更好,如果不能,就先凑完全平方,再求根,比如x^2-6x+4=0直接用韦达肯定麻烦,凑完全平方x^2-6x+9-5=0(x-3)^2=5这样两个根,一目了然.
方程有什么最大值?方程只有“有解”“无解”令函数f(x)=-2*x^2+3*x+5,求它的极值下面是求极值symsxdf=diff(-2*x^2+3*x+5)f=inline('-2*x^2+3*x+
(a+b)x的平方+(a-c)x+4分之(a-c)=0有两个相等的实数根,判别式=(a-c)²-(a+b)(a-c)=0即:-(a-c)(b+c)=0因为b+c≠0,即:a=c那么以a,b,
楼主,你好:∵关于x的一元二次方程3x²+2(a+b+c)x+(ab+bc+ca)=0有两个相等实根∴△=4(a+b+c)²-12(ab+bc+ca)=a²+b²
矩阵问题:求出x1^2x2^2x3^2x1x2x3111的逆矩阵,用这个逆矩阵右乘(y1,y2,y2),就分别的a,b,c
double类型的不能直接用==0来判断,用fabs(a)
#include#includeintmain(){floata,b,c;floatx1,x2,det;cout
打酱油